Role of biochemical constituents in resistance against alternaria blight of sunflower.

The sunflower germplasm showing resistant, moderately resistant and susceptible reactions against Alternaria blight in field conditions were assessed for change in chlorophyll, phenol and sugar content after inoculation of Alternaria helianthi under glass house conditions The chlorophyll content decreased due to the infection of A. helianthi. The rate of decrease was more in susceptible entries (54.53%) than resistant entries (15.10%). Sugar and phenol content were increased due to the infection of A. helianthi. The rate of increase was higher in resistant entries (7.07 and 19.52%) than susceptible entries (4.20 and 6.78%).
